Chuanxiao Cheng

Doctor, Lecturer

ADDRESS: NO.5 Dongfeng Road Zhengzhou Henan China, 450002

PHONE13676995654

FAX0371-63624381

E-mailcxcheng@zzuli.edu.cn

Websites

Research fields: Heat and mass transfer of PCM; Cold, heat and gas storage based PCM; Combined utilization of solar energy

Education background

2015.09—Now, Zhengzhou University of Light Industry, College of energy and power engineering, Lecturer.

2009.09—2015.09 Dalian University of Technology, Energy and Environmental Engineering, Master and Doctor.

2005.09—2009.07 Henan Agricultural University, Energy and Environmental Engineering, Undergraduate course.

Teaching courseHeat transferThe principle and application of energy storageThe machinery foundation of thermal energy and powerRefrigerating House Designet al.
